Emerging Trends in GIS Auditing: A Shift towards Predictive Analytics

The field of GIS auditing is witnessing a significant shift towards predictive analytics, enabling auditors to forecast potential risks and anomalies. With the integration of machine learning algorithms and spatial analysis, auditors can now identify high-risk areas and predict the likelihood of non-compliance. This trend is expected to continue, with the increasing adoption of artificial intelligence and data science in auditing. Innovations in GIS Auditing: Cloud-Based Solutions and Collaboration Tools

The advancement of cloud-based solutions and collaboration tools has transformed the way auditors work with GIS data. Cloud-based platforms enable seamless data sharing, real-time collaboration, and scalable processing of large datasets. Innovations like Esri's ArcGIS Online and Google Cloud's Geospatial Platform have made it possible for auditors to access and analyze GIS data from anywhere, at any time. Furthermore, collaboration tools like Slack and Trello facilitate communication and teamwork among auditors, stakeholders, and subject matter experts. Future Developments in GIS Auditing: Integrating Internet of Things (IoT) and Big Data

The future of GIS auditing holds immense promise, with the potential integration of Internet of Things (IoT) and Big Data. IoT sensors and devices can provide real-time data on environmental, social, and economic factors, enabling auditors to conduct more comprehensive and dynamic audits. The combination of GIS, IoT, and Big Data will revolutionize the auditing landscape, allowing professionals to analyze vast amounts of data, identify patterns, and predict outcomes.
